区块链行业开发方向有哪
2026-04-16
说到区块链,最近这几年热度真是没得说,不管是大家茶余饭后的闲聊,还是那些投资圈的老炮儿,动不动就提起“区块链”俩字。不过,说实话,很多人其实对它的具体开发方向还是懵逼状态,甚至我身边的朋友都是摸着石头过河,让我来跟大家聊聊这个话题。
直接说开发方向,最核心的有三种:公链、私链和联盟链。公链呢,简单来说就是大家都能参与的,比如比特币、以太坊这些。它的特性是开放的,透明且去中心化,听上去很美,但其实你遇到的技术难题也不少。
然后就是私链,顾名思义,只有特定的人能使用,这常常应用在金融、供应链等行业。做私链的项目相对来说,门槛和技术难度都低一些,但在用的时候,你会发现也不见得省心,特别是涉及到数据隐私的时候,不小心就可能把信息泄露出去了。
再说联盟链,这其实是公链和私链的结合,有些公司和机构合作开发使用,像Hyperledger Fabric这种就属于这一类。联盟链的好处是可以让几个信任的参与者共同维护网络,缺点是去中心化程度不够,容易出现信任问题。
不少小伙伴刚接触区块链,可能一头雾水,以为只要会写代码就行,殊不知这些坑我之前也吃过。第一个蠢事,就是盲目跟风,看到某个项目火就开始大搞特搞,搞一堆美轮美奂的计划书,结果发现完全不符合市场需求,真的是浪费时间和金钱。
第二个蠢事就是过于依赖开源项目,确实开源项目能给你省不少时间,但是你真正做出的产品不能完全抄。因为每个项目的环境、需求都不一样,你拿别人的解决方案来套你自己的业务,结果往往会导致很多隐性问题,直到上线后才发现。
最后一个就是没有做好链上数据的维护。很多新手开发者觉得把智能合约写好就万事大吉了,实际上这也是个长期的工作,链上的资产管理、数据更新都需要持续维护。你想,哪个项目不希望自己能在技术上持久发展,而不是泡沫一夜之间就炸了?
现如今区块链的应用场景也越来越多,最开始大家都说是数字货币支付,其实这只是个切入点。最近比较火的还有供应链管理、数字身份、版权保护等。这些应用场景的开发都需要注重实际业务需求,千万别单纯为了“区块链”这个名词而开发产品。不然你最终可能面临资金打水漂的风险。
要知道,好的应用场景是解决实际问题的,像现在很多企业在追求透明性,区块链刚好能解决这一需求。比如在农产品溯源中,利用区块链记录每一步的生产流程,这样消费者才能真正相信他们吃的究竟是什么。记得我曾经参与一个项目的时候,也曾面临类似的挑战,最终通过区块链将整个产业链都给串联了起来,做出来的效果是喜人的。
其实选择哪个区块链开发框架是非常重要的,有些小伙伴可能会觉得,随便选一个就行,反正都在搞区块链。但我跟你说,这可不是小事,太多项目因为这个下了大坑。比如以太坊的智能合约开发,技术门槛就相对高,虽然功能强大,但对新手来说,一开始接触可能得看不少资料,还得搭建一些环境,折腾了半天才能出个小demo。
再反观一些更简单的,比如Hyperledger Fabric,虽然相对来说功能上没那么丰富,但其入门门槛低,社区支持也不错,适合初学者。而且,如果你想进入企业级市场,Hyperledger就是个不错的选择,很多大企业都在使用。
可能很多人不知道,其实区块链行业里面有些潜规则,这些都是圈内人心照不宣的。比如开发者之间关于区块链的架构设计上,很多时候不是最先进的技术就最好,有很多时候是要根据项目要求去选择合适的技术栈。想清楚你的项目功能是什么,再从中找合适的工具。
还有啊,圈子里很多人专注于技术堆砌,常常搞得自己跟个技术宅似的,结果最后发现,客观上并不会对产品的实际推广起到很大帮助。有时候你需要的其实是更好的市场策略、合适的商业模式,而不是单纯追求技术上的完美
在结合行业动态和自身开发过程中,我们会遇到些技术障碍。比如,有次我在开发一个去中心化交易所时,遭遇到性能瓶颈,整体交易延时增长,用户开始抱怨。这种情况让我真的意识到,团队的技术能力和解决问题的能力是相辅相成的。我们及时进行架构,最后通过引入侧链技术解决了交易性能的问题,用户反馈逐渐改善。
同时,还得考虑安全性问题,智能合约一旦上线就无法修改,这个不懂的朋友可以参照ERC-20标准出发。因此我强烈建议开发之前就一定要进行全面的测试,包括单元测试、集成测试等,别到上线后才发现有漏洞,那真是得不偿失。
未来的发展趋势很明显,像跨链技术、Layer 2解决方案可能会越来越受欢迎。跨链能够实现不同区块链之间的互通,这是个大趋势,不仅能够提升用户体验,还能吸引更多的新用户加入。同时,Layer 2,也就是在原有区块链上搭建第二层,来实现更高的速度和低的交易费用。
如果不重视这些新兴技术,可能你做的区块链项目就跟不上时代发展了。别小看这些技术,大公司在这方面投入也是越来越多,多少企业在排队上链,未来的行业竞争将变得更加激烈。
综上所述,区块链开发方向多而复杂,但只要你理清思路,加上实践中的摸索,就一定能找到合适的切入点。当然,前路会有不少挑战,但掌握了必要的知识和技能,就能勇闯这条不平凡的道路!